Double miles on West Coast - LHR/FRA flights

Starts tomorrow.

Between Nov 5 - Dec 14

YYC-FRA & YYC-LHR & YVR-LHR

Double miles for each roundtrip or 2 one way segments.

All revenue booking classes are eligible.

Fly non-stop between Calgary and Frankfurt, Calgary and London, or between Vancouver and London with Air Canada and earn Double Aeroplan Miles

Offer Validity
From November 5, 2003
To December 14, 2003

Europe is now closer than ever! Between November 5 and December 14, 2003, earn Double Aeroplan Miles when you fly on scheduled non-stop flights operated by Air Canada for every roundtrip or 2 one-way segments in any booking class* on the following routes:


between Calgary and Frankfurt
between Calgary and London
or between Vancouver and London

There is no limit to how often you can make use of this promotion.

Note it doesn't say double status miles, it says double AP miles.
